Brij Bhushan Singh: In a brand new improvement, the Ayodhya district administration denied permission to BJP MP and former Wrestling Federation of India chief Brij Bhushan Sharan Singh to carry a rally in Ayodhya. However, Singh posted on Facebook that he’s suspending his upcoming rally slated to be held on June 5 in Ayodhya. He cited instructions from the Supreme Court amid the investigation of sexual assault allegations towards him.
Circle workplace SP Gautam mentioned permission was denied in view of the opposite programmes scheduled for the World Environment Day on June 5.
Details of FIRs made public
Earlier within the morning, the main points of two FIRs and 10 complaints of sexual harassment filed towards him by 7 feminine wrestlers have been launched within the public area.
According to the main points within the FIRs and complaints registered within the case, the WFI chief has been accused of demanding sexual favours from every one of many seven complainants. Further, at the least 10 complaints of molestation have additionally been registered towards him.
Singh writes Facebook submit
The BJP MP mentioned in his Facebook submit that he respects the “Supreme Court’s directions” and is prepared to cooperate with the police investigating the case towards him.
“Some political parties are trying to disturb social harmony by promoting provincialism, regionalism and caste conflict through rallies. That is why we had decided to organise a Sant Sammelan at Ayodhya on June 5 to deliberate on the evil spreading in the entire society,” Singh wrote in his submit ,.
“But now that the police are investigating the allegations, I respect the serious directions issued by the Supreme Court. The ‘Jan Chetna Maharali, Ayodhya Chalo’ programme that was to be held on June 5 in Ayodhya, is therefore postponed for a few days,” he wrote, with out confirming when the rally will probably be held subsequent.
He additionally thanked the “lakhs of supporters and well-wishers from all religions, castes and regions” that supported him “in a humble way on this issue”.
“With your support, I have served as a member of the Lok Sabha for the last 28 years. I have tried to unite people of all castes, communities and religions, both in power and in the Opposition. For these reasons, my political opponents and their parties have levelled false allegations against me,” he added. “I express my gratitude to everyone and assure you that my family and I will always be indebted to you,” he wrote.
